对象存储采用什么结构来管理所有数据,对象存储数据调度策略研究,结构优化与性能提升探讨
- 综合资讯
- 2025-03-25 12:56:22
- 4

对象存储采用树状结构管理数据,通过数据调度策略优化性能,研究聚焦于结构优化,旨在提升存储效率与处理速度。...
对象存储采用树状结构管理数据,通过数据调度策略优化性能,研究聚焦于结构优化,旨在提升存储效率与处理速度。
随着互联网的快速发展,数据量呈爆炸式增长,对象存储作为海量数据存储的重要手段,在云计算、大数据等领域得到了广泛应用,对象存储系统通过采用分布式存储架构,实现了海量数据的存储、访问和管理,在数据调度过程中,如何合理分配存储资源,提高数据访问效率,成为制约对象存储性能的关键因素,本文旨在探讨对象存储支持的数据调度策略,分析不同调度策略的优缺点,并提出一种基于结构优化的数据调度策略,以期为对象存储性能提升提供理论依据。
对象存储结构概述
对象存储系统采用分布式存储架构,将数据分散存储在多个节点上,以下是几种常见的对象存储结构:
图片来源于网络,如有侵权联系删除
-
集中式存储结构:所有数据存储在一个中心节点上,其他节点通过网络访问中心节点,这种结构简单易实现,但中心节点容易成为性能瓶颈。
-
分布式存储结构:数据分散存储在多个节点上,节点之间通过P2P网络进行数据交换,这种结构具有良好的可扩展性和容错性,但数据访问效率受网络带宽限制。
-
混合存储结构:结合集中式和分布式存储结构的优点,将数据按照一定规则分散存储在多个节点上,同时保证数据访问效率。
对象存储数据调度策略
-
随机调度策略:根据数据访问请求,随机选择一个节点进行数据存储或访问,这种策略简单易实现,但可能导致数据访问不均衡,影响系统性能。
-
负载均衡调度策略:根据节点负载情况,动态调整数据存储和访问节点,这种策略能够有效提高系统性能,但实现复杂,需要实时监控节点负载。
-
预热调度策略:根据历史访问数据,预测未来数据访问热点,提前将热点数据存储在性能较好的节点上,这种策略能够提高数据访问效率,但需要大量历史数据支持。
-
数据副本调度策略:将数据存储在多个节点上,实现数据冗余和容错,这种策略能够提高数据可靠性,但会占用更多存储资源。
图片来源于网络,如有侵权联系删除
结构优化数据调度策略
针对现有数据调度策略的不足,本文提出一种基于结构优化的数据调度策略,具体如下:
-
数据分区:将数据按照一定规则进行分区,如按时间、地域、应用类型等,每个分区存储在性能相近的节点上,降低数据访问延迟。
-
节点分组:将节点按照性能、地理位置等因素进行分组,提高数据访问效率,分组内节点采用负载均衡调度策略,分组间采用数据副本调度策略。
-
动态调整:根据数据访问热点和节点负载情况,动态调整数据分区和节点分组,如数据访问热点发生变化,则重新进行数据分区和节点分组。
-
智能预测:结合历史访问数据和机器学习算法,预测未来数据访问热点,提前将热点数据存储在性能较好的节点上。
本文针对对象存储数据调度策略进行了研究,分析了现有调度策略的优缺点,并提出了一种基于结构优化的数据调度策略,该策略通过数据分区、节点分组、动态调整和智能预测等手段,有效提高了数据访问效率和系统性能,在实际应用中,可根据具体需求和场景,对策略进行调整和优化,以实现更好的性能表现。
本文链接:https://www.zhitaoyun.cn/1895525.html
发表评论